Ingredients to use to prepare zucchini pie
- 2 zucchini
- A goat cheese roll
- A puff pastry roll
- 15 cl of thick fresh cream
- 1 tablespoon dried thyme or rosemary
- salt and pepper
- 1 splash of olive oil
How to make a zucchini and goat cheese pie?
- Start by spreading the puff pastry on a baking sheet;

- Use a fork to prick the dough to prevent it from puffing up;
- Bake your dough at 180°C for 5 to 7 minutes;
- Cut the zucchini into thin slices;
- Cut the goat cheese into slices;
- Once your dough is pre-baked, spread the crème fraîche over it and sprinkle with a little dried thyme or rosemary;


- Then, place the zucchini slices in a rosette shape;

- Season the zucchini with salt and pepper to taste and spread the goat cheese slices over the tart;

- Sprinkle some herbs over the cake to decorate, not forgetting to add a drizzle of olive oil at the end;
- Bake your cake at 180°C for 30 min.

How to make a zucchini pie without fresh cream?
Yes, it is entirely possible to do without crème fraîche and any dairy products or fats. Instead, use tomato sauce, pesto sauce or mustard.
Here are some other alternatives to crème fraîche:
Soy milk and olive oil.
Mix 159 ml of soy milk with 79 ml of olive oil to get the equivalent of 1 cup of heavy cream. You use it to line your cake.
Milk and cornstarch
To thicken milk and obtain a texture reminiscent of crème fraîche, nothing beats using cornstarch.
To replace 1 cup of heavy cream, or 237 ml, mix 19 g of cornstarch with 237 ml of milk. Stir to thicken the mixture.
For an even lower fat, lower calorie cream, use skim milk.
Milk and Greek yogurt
Rich in protein, Greek yogurt has several health benefits. To make thick Greek yogurt thinner, you can mix it with equal parts of whole milk.
How to make a zucchini and ricotta pie without puff pastry?
Ingredients
- 900 g zucchini cut into thin slices
- 4 large eggs
- 355ml of milk
- 50 g of breadcrumbs
- 226 g ricotta cheese
- 110 g grated pecorino romano cheese
- salt and pepper
- 1 pinch red pepper flakes
- 1 teaspoon fresh thyme
- 2 tablespoons chopped fresh parsley leaves
Instructions
- We start by preheating the oven to 180°C.
- Grease a tart tin of approximately 22 cm diameter with oil and then sprinkle with breadcrumbs;
- Turn the pan to coat the edges and bottom with breadcrumbs;
- In a large bowl, beat the eggs with the ricotta, half the pecorino cheese and the milk until smooth;
- Add salt, pepper, thyme, parsley and dried red pepper flakes for a spicy flavor;
- Add the zucchini slices to the egg and cheese mixture while stirring gently;
- Pour the mixture into the mold, then sprinkle the remaining grated pecorino cheese;
- Bake the zucchini pie for about 50 minutes until golden brown;
- Let cool to room temperature and then start tasting!
